logo

Output f3cbdf2606f97b265b1c1f9323b5e458305eaf039a0fe9ea52aea244cee2a974:2

value
1507013526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b0591bf9edfdc91a03837cff2a9826b44c3246b OP_EQUAL
address
32hJ2cnJQEDTmCc3N6o1ws8RHb4of3C7Sn
transaction
f3cbdf2606f97b265b1c1f9323b5e458305eaf039a0fe9ea52aea244cee2a974